A 2000-year temperature reconstruction on the East Antarctic plateau, from argon-nitrogen and water stable isotopes in the Aurora Basin North ice core

Here we present the results from the Aurora Basin North (ABN) ice core (71° S, 111° E, 2690 m a.s.l.) in the lower part of the East Antarctic plateau where accumulation is substantially higher than other ice core drilling sites on the plateau, and provide unprecedented insight in East Antarctic past temperature variability. We reconstructed the temperature of the last 2000 years using two independent methods: the widely used water stable isotopes (δ18O), and by inverse modelling of borehole temperature and past temperature gradients estimated from the inert gas stable isotopes (δ40Ar and δ15N). This second reconstruction is based on three independent measurement types: borehole temperature, firn thickness, and firn temperature gradient.More information on the data and the methods can be found in the accompanying publication: Servettaz, A. P. M., Orsi, A. J., Curran, M. A. J., Moy, A. D., Landais, A., McConnell, J. R., Popp, T. J., Le Meur, E., Faïn, X., and Chappelaz, J., : A 2000-year temperature reconstruction on the East Antarctic plateau, from argon-nitrogen and water stable isotopes in the Aurora Basin North ice core [submitted] Clim. Past.Please see the manuscript for further details on unit of measurements and abbreviations used for the data set.
